The Environmental Impact of Traditional LawnMowers

Traditional lawn mowers, especially gas-powered ones, have a significant environmental impact. They emit harmful pollutants like carbon monoxide and nitrogen oxides into the air, contributing to smog and respiratory issues.

Moreover, gas mowers are notoriously loud. The noise pollution can disturb not only your peace but also local wildlife. Birds flee, and other animals retreat as the roar of engines invades their habitat.

Fuel spills during refueling can contaminate the soil in your yard, posing risks for plants and pets.

Then there’s the issue of fossil fuel consumption. Each time you use a gas mower, you use non-renewable resources that contribute to climate change.

Switching to more sustainable options could make a world of difference for our environment while keeping our lawns looking pristine.

Advantages of Using Battery-Powered Lawn Mowers

Battery-powered lawnmowers are changing the game for homeowners. They offer a quiet and efficient mowing experience without the roar of traditional gas engines.

One significant advantage is their environmental impact. These mowers produce zero emissions, making them an eco-friendly choice. This means cleaner air and a healthier planet.

They are also lightweight and easy to maneuver. With less effort than heavier models, homeowners can easily navigate tight corners and uneven surfaces.

Another perk is maintenance simplicity. Battery mowers require no oil changes or spark plug replacements, saving time and money in upkeep.

Moreover, many models have innovative features like adjustable cutting heights and intelligent technology for improved efficiency.

These benefits showcase how battery-powered options cater to modern needs while promoting sustainability.

Tips for Maintenance and Longevity of Battery Mowers

Proper maintenance is essential to ensure your lightweight battery mower performs at its best and lasts years. Start by regularly checking the blades. Keeping them sharp makes cutting more efficient and reduces strain on the motor. Dull blades can tear the grass instead of cutting it cleanly, leading to a less healthy lawn.

Clean your mower after each use. Grass clippings can accumulate under the deck, leading to rust or damage over time. A simple rinse with water or using a brush will do wonders in maintaining its condition.

Battery care is also crucial. When not in use, store your batteries in a cool, dry place away from extreme temperatures that could reduce their lifespan. It’s also advisable to avoid letting them fully discharge before recharging; this practice helps maintain optimal performance.

Check all connections periodically to ensure they are secure and free of corrosion. These small steps can significantly extend the life of your lightweight battery mower while keeping it running efficiently.
